Default Traction Bars are finally done

It took a while to get all of the supplies and time to finish my traction bars but they are finally finished. The joints are Ballistics Fabrication heavy duty 3", the tubing is DOM 1.5" ID 2.25" OD .375" wall. The mounting brackets were made from scrap that was laying around. I wanted something short so that I can put it on the lift without having to make any adjustments and stout so that I never have to worry about them breaking or bending.

The joints were roughly $80 each and the tubing was $17/foot. The mounts were made from tubing that I had laying around and the bolts, nuts, and washers were $40. For a grand total of roughly $520. I know that I could have bought a set for a very similar amount but not of this quality, strength, and a specified length.
